They raise revenue for state and local governments

Lotteries are a way for state and local governments to raise revenue. Some states channel lottery proceeds directly into the general budget, while others use it to fund various programs. For example, 23 states have set aside money from the sales of lottery tickets to support gambling addiction treatment programs. According to the National Council on Problem Gambling, there are approximately two million Americans who are addicted to gambling. A third of those are considered to be problem gamblers.
